What is the definition of cancer?

Uncontrolled growth and proliferation of abnormal cells.

2
New cards

What differentiates benign from malignant tumors?

Benign tumors can become malignant if insulted; malignant tumors invade, metastasize, and evade apoptosis.

3
New cards

What are hallmark signs of cancer cells?

Evasion of apoptosis, atypical energy production, and immune system evasion.

4
New cards

What does cancer remission mean?

Reduction or disappearance of cancer signs and symptoms; not always a cure but indicates less detectable disease.

5
New cards

What are the top 4 most common cancers in the U.S.?

Lung, breast, prostate, colorectal.

6
New cards

Which cancers are most lethal?

Lung, colorectal, pancreatic, and breast cancers.

7
New cards

Which cancers are increasing in men and women?

Men → Prostate; Women → Liver and bile duct.

8
New cards

Which cancers are decreasing in men?

Lung and laryngeal cancers.

9
New cards

What are acquired causes of cancer?

Radiation, chemical carcinogens, viral infections (EBV, HPV).

10
New cards

What are inherited causes of cancer?

Lynch syndrome and other genetic mutations.

11
New cards

List common cancer risk factors.

Age, smoking, obesity, alcohol, sun exposure, gender, diet, occupational exposures.

12
New cards

How does obesity increase cancer risk?

Chronic inflammation and hyperinsulinemia promote abnormal cell growth.

13
New cards

What is the Two-Hit Hypothesis?

1st hit = loss of tumor suppressor gene; 2nd hit = activation of proto-oncogene → tumor formation.

14
New cards

How can drugs affect gene expression in cancer?

By altering methylation or histone modification without changing DNA sequence.

15
New cards

What tests (labs or scans) detect or screen for cancer?

MRI, CT, targeted ultrasound, PET, CBC, hormones, liquid biopsy.

16
New cards

What are common screening tests by cancer type? ( cancer type specific

Mammogram (breast), Pap (cervical), PSA (prostate), colonoscopy (colon).

17
New cards

What is a liquid biopsy?

Blood test detecting circulating tumor cells or cfDNA/RNA for screening and monitoring.

18
New cards

What cell defines Hodgkin lymphoma?

Reed–Sternberg B cells.

19
New cards

What virus is associated with Hodgkin lymphoma?

Epstein–Barr virus (EBV).

20
New cards

What are symptoms of lymphoma?

Fever, night sweats, weight loss, fatigue.

21
New cards

What is multiple myeloma?

Plasma-cell cancer in bone marrow; 60% 5-yr survival; long remission but no cure.

What are sarcomas?

Bone or soft-tissue cancers (osteosarcoma, leiomyosarcoma, liposarcoma, Kaposi).

23
New cards

Which skin cancer is most aggressive?

Melanoma.

24
New cards

What are skin-cancer risk factors?

Fair skin, light hair/eyes, sunburns, arsenic exposure, immunosuppression.

25
New cards

Which type of sunscreen is preferred?

Mineral (physical) sunscreen.

26
New cards

What is chemotherapy?

Nonspecific cytotoxic agents that kill rapidly dividing cells (both cancer and normal).

27
New cards

What is radiation therapy used for?

Local control and pain management; not curative but slows progression.

28
New cards

What cancers use hormone therapy?

Prostate and breast cancers.

29
New cards

What is immunotherapy?

Treatment that stimulates the immune system to attack cancer (CAR-T, checkpoint inhibitors).

30
New cards

What is photodynamic therapy?

Light-activated drugs that destroy cancer cells.

31
New cards

What is the Warburg effect?

Cancer cells use anaerobic glycolysis → lactate buildup → acidic immunosuppressive environment.

32
New cards

Which medication counteracts the Warburg effect?

Metformin.

33
New cards

Which chromosome defines CML?

Philadelphia chromosome (BCR-ABL).

34
New cards

What defines Polycythemia Vera?

Elevated H/H causing hyperviscosity and thrombosis.

35
New cards

List major cancer-prevention strategies.

Exercise, healthy diet, HPV vaccine, sun protection, routine screening, smoking cessation.

36
New cards

Why is DVT in cancer considered provoked?

Due to ↑ factor X, cytokines, platelet activation, and endothelial damage from chemo.

37
New cards

How is cancer-associated DVT treated?

Heparin /LMWH → DOACs (Apixaban 10 mg BID × 10 days then 5 mg BID).

38
New cards

When should Apixaban dose be reduced?

Age ≥ 80, weight < 60 kg, or Cr > 1.5.

39
New cards

What causes pericardial effusion in cancer?

Thoracic malignancy, radiation, or renal impairment.

40
New cards

What is a complication of untreated pericardial effusion?

Cardiac tamponade → needs drainage or pericardial window.

41
New cards

When does febrile neutropenia typically occur post-chemo?

1–2 weeks after chemotherapy.

42
New cards

What is first-line management? for neutropenia fever

Immediate broad-spectrum antibiotics (Zosyn + Vancomycin).

43
New cards

What are the causes of thrombocytopenia?

Consumption (trauma/surgery), destruction (HIT), production failure (bone marrow suppression).

44
New cards

What are hallmark lab findings in TLS?

↑K, ↑Phosphate, ↑Uric acid, ↓Calcium.

45
New cards

When is TLS most likely to occur?

12–72 hours after starting chemo or radiation.

46
New cards

How is TLS managed?

IV hydration, Rasburicase or Allopurinol, phosphate binders, calcium gluconate, dialysis if severe.

47
New cards

What is GVHD?

Immune attack on host tissues after bone-marrow transplant.

48
New cards

What are symptoms of GVHD?

Rash, liver inflammation, diarrhea, GI bleeding.

49
New cards

How is GVHD treated?

Immunosuppression (Tacrolimus, Rituximab).

50
New cards

What causes SVC syndrome in cancer?

Compression by lung cancer, lymphoma, or thrombosis.

51
New cards

What are key symptoms of SVC syndrome?

Facial/upper-body edema, JVD, stridor, seizures.

52
New cards

What is the treatment for SVC syndrome?

Stent placement or radiation therapy.

53
New cards

What characterizes nephrotic syndrome?

Proteinuria > 3.5 g/day, hypoalbuminemia, edema, lipiduria.

54
New cards

How does cancer cause nephrotic syndrome?

Tumor cells clog glomeruli → protein and lipid leakage.

55
New cards

What causes Cushing’s in cancer?

Ectopic ACTH/cortisol production (lung or thyroid cancer).

56
New cards

How is Cushing’s diagnosed?

24-hour urine cortisol and dexamethasone suppression test.

57
New cards

What is the treatment for Cushing’s?

Adrenalectomy or tumor resection.

58
New cards

What serum level defines hypercalcemia of malignancy?

Calcium > 10.5 mg/dL.

59
New cards

What causes hypercalcemia of malignancy?

Tumor secretion of PTH-related peptide (PTHrP) → bone resorption and Ca release.

60
New cards

What are symptoms of hypercalcemia of malignancy?

Weakness, confusion, dehydration, sluggish reflexes, constipation.

61
New cards

How is hypercalcemia treated?

IV fluids, bisphosphonates, calcitonin, glucocorticoids, loop diuretics, rehydration.
